Why does Crutchfield website indicate the AVN-5435 does not fit a 2005 Tundra DC? Does it fit? Do the steering wheel controls work with the stereo?

Default Crutchfield/5435

It definately fits. Just got the 5495 and it fits perfect. The steering wheels are a direct plug in in the 35 and and requires a seperate interface for the 95. Eclipse will have to change this, they F***** up with the newer version 5495's. With the new internet pricing on the eclipse units I opted to still go through a dealer, eclipse is going through crutchfield to be a little more competitive but I think you are better off thru a specialty dealer. Better warranty,peace of mind and they aren't going to turn down a customer so they will match or beat the price. Good luck.
